The Attorney-General has been using my remarks in our pre-election policy to justify his pay-cutting laws, which they did not tell the voters about before the last election. It was done in three ways. He quoted from a speech. He said that he was using my Labor policies as inspiration for his pay-cutting laws. The first of the three ways in which that's wrong is that it's untrue. I spoke about megaprojects, not projects of $250 million. I certainly did not speak about greenfields agreements without unions; they were to be with unions. And we did not speak about eight years. That was the untrue part of his quote. But he also omitted other parts of our industrial relations policies.
